☐ Shared lab access — our new starter will be using the Fenwick Lab on Level 2, which we share with the Calder team, so a quick heads-up: book bench time via the wall calendar, not the app (long story). Show them where the goggles and spill kit live, and introduce them to whoever's around from Calder. The lab door won't take their badge until Thursday, so they'll need the keypad code below.

staff pass of kawip-hawef = bdg-QLP-2

Ticket #— Floor 9 Opening Prep, Brindlemoor House

Hi facilities folks, Floor 9 opens to staff next Monday and we need a few things squared away before then. Lift access is live, but the two side doors by the kitchenette are still on the old lock config — please reprogram them before Friday. Also, signage for the quiet rooms hasn't arrived, so pop up the temporary printed ones for now. Until the badge readers sync, the interim door code for Floor 9 is below.

door code, bajop-bajog: bdg-DSWAC-43621

Plugin authors extending the CareChime appointment reminder job should read configuration only through the provided config API, never directly from process environment. REMINDER_WINDOW_HOURS controls how far ahead reminders are sent; plugins must respect it rather than scheduling independently. LOCALE_DEFAULT affects message templating and may be overridden per clinic. The job itself authenticates to the messaging gateway before any plugin hooks run, using a credential defined on the next line of the env file:

secret setting of yajog-taguf: ARCHIVE_KEY3=051

Step 4 — upgrading Corville Broker from 3.x to 4.x. Drain the consumers first (the Lintfall dashboard shows lag per queue — wait until it hits zero, seriously, don't skip this). Then stop the broker, swap the package, and migrate the data dir with the bundled tool. Before bringing it back up, update the broker's .env so the new auth scheme works. The inter-node cluster secret goes on the very next line.

env line for fafof-fahag: LEDGER_TOKEN5=f8790